A bill making daylight saving time permanent could have sizable implications for observant Jews, whose daily schedules are tied to the rising and setting of the sun. On March 15, the United States Senate unanimously approved the Sunshine Protection Act in a voice vote, according to Reuters. If approved by the House of Representatives and signed by President Joe Biden, the bill would take effect in 2023. Starting next year, the Sunshine Protection Act could end America’s twice-yearly ritual of changing all its clocks.
